    It is up to you whether you want to install Windows using MBR or GPT and you need to set the option in the BIOS for MBR or GPT style installation.

    Having said that. Here's the steps:
    1. Disconnect all HD/SSD except the one you will be installing Windows
    2. From the boot menu, Select #1 for GPT or select #2 for MBR to boot up the Windows Installation
      Attachment 29081
      NOTE: The screen is an example and might look different from yours
    3. Once the Windows Installation started. On the first screen, Press and hold SHIFT Key + F10, a command Windows will popup then type:
      - diskpart
      - select disk 0
      - Clean
      - Exit
      - Exit
    4. Click Next to continue.
    5. Select Custom
    6. Select the first unallocated partition and click next. Windows will create all needed partitions to install Windows 10
    7. Follow all the rest of the instruction to complete.

    MBR installation:
    1. 500MB System Reserved partition
    2. C: Drive
    GPT installation:
    1. 450MB recovery partition
    2. 100MB EFI System Partition
    3. 16MB MSR partition
    4. C drive.

    I suggest you to check for any pending updates on the system and install the updates if any. You may follow the below steps to check and install the updates.


    • Go to Start and then
      Settings.

    • Click on Update and Recovery.

    • Check for updates under
      Windows Updates.

    • Restart the system and check if the issue is resolved.


    If the issue still persist, you may update the
    display Adapters driver
    and check if the issue still persist. To update the display driver, please follow the below steps:


    • Select the Start button, type
      Device Manager,
      then select it from the list of results.

    • Expand one of the categories to find the Display Adapters Driver, then right-click (or tap and hold) it, and select
      Update Driver Software.

    • Select Search automatically for updated driver software.

    • If Windows doesn’t find a new driver, you can try looking for one on the device manufacturer’s website and follow their instructions.
    Note: If that does not help, uninstall/reinstall the display driver by following the above steps. To uninstall the display adapter driver, right click on the driver and uninstall it.
